The primary purpose of the sports pre-participation evaluation is to screen for underlying medical conditions and to ensure the athlete is in optimal health for the chosen sport. The athlete's personal and family medical history identifies most conditions that restrict participation or require further evaluation.
The goal of the sports physical, also known as the Preparticipation Physical Evaluation (PPE), is to promote the health and safety of athletes in training and competition. The PPE is to facilitate and encourage safe participation in sports, not to exclude athletes from participation.
Preparticipation Physical Evaluation Overview If this is not possible, the PPE should be conducted at least 6 weeks before the first preseason practice to allow time to evaluate the athlete and treat any medical conditions found during the visit.

There are two main elements of the PPE: (1) An assessment of the athlete's medical history and (2) A physical examination with pertinent emphases for the active individual. Medical history: The medical history should review past illness and surgeries, current ongoing conditions and a focused family medical history.
The purpose of pre-participation screening in sports is to decrease the number of sport-related injuries and death by identifying individual abnormalities that may predispose an athlete to injury.
The main goal in performing pre-participation or performance screenings is to decrease injuries, enhance performance, and ultimately improve quality of life.
This includes vital signs and an exam of each of the following: general appearance, vision, hearing, lymph nodes, heart, lungs, abdomen, skin, nervous system and musculoskeletal system.

Athlete Pre-Participation Health History is a comprehensive assessment tool that collects information about an athlete's medical history, current health status, and any previous injuries or conditions that may affect their ability to participate in sports.
Typically, all athletes, especially those participating in school sports, club teams, or any organized athletic events, are required to file an Athlete Pre-Participation Health History form before they are allowed to compete.
To fill out the Athlete Pre-Participation Health History, the athlete or their guardian should carefully read each question, provide accurate and complete information regarding medical history, current health conditions, allergies, medications, and any past injuries, and then submit the form to the designated authority.
The purpose of Athlete Pre-Participation Health History is to identify any potential health risks or medical concerns that could affect an athlete's ability to compete safely, as well as to ensure their overall well-being during athletic participation.
The information that must be reported on Athlete Pre-Participation Health History includes personal details (name, age, sport), medical history (previous injuries or surgeries), current health conditions, medication use, allergies, family medical history, and any other relevant health information.
